    You only have a few days left to submit your class proposals for the 2019 Annual PTG Convention which will be held in Tuscon, Arizona July 10 - 13th, 2019.  Submit them to Home 

     
    I'm looking for the following classes:
    Roberts Rules of Order - helpful for Chapter leaders and for those seeking to join a Board within the PTG
    The Practical use of Historical Temperaments
    Small Business Accounting
    History of Baldwin, Kimball, Wurlitzer (let's hear from those that were there before they are gone and their stories gone with them)
    The Modern Straight Strung Piano (Paulello, Arno, Barenboim - Chris Maene, Erard)
    Squares, Birdcages, Vellum, OH MY!!
    How to Tune and Perform Maintenance on Player Piano.

    As of now there are no plans to bring back the Drop In Shop, but I would like to have various hands-on stations set up in the same room as the Competency Playground for How to measure Hammers for Boring, Boring a hammer, Repairing a Yamaha Hammer Flange String.  How about a piano with messed up dampers and you can get one to work properly.  If you could teach one of these hand-on repairs or can think of others, please email me at douglas@magnumopuspianoworks.com
